Chests of Cai Shen
PragmaticPlay
Review byCreated: 08/10/2024Updated: 13/10/2024
Related Games
Bigger Bass Blizzard - Christmas Catch
PragmaticPlay
Please open website in Safari to install the App.
×PragmaticPlay
Review byCreated: 08/10/2024Updated: 13/10/2024
Please open website in Safari to install the App.
×